Job Description & How to Apply Below
- Perform defined research and laboratory tests and experiments according to prescribed protocols and schedules
- Set up experiments as prescribed by the principal investigator
- Conduct studies in fruit flies (Drosophila) investigating how neural circuits process information
- Perform dissections and immunostaining of fly brains, behavioral assays, optogenetic manipulations, and in vivo imaging of neural activity
- Assist with building experimental hardware or writing software, depending on interests and skills
- Maintain fly stocks and perform general laboratory tasks
- Participate in laboratory maintenance, including sterilization, equipment cleaning, supply ordering, inventory, and media preparation
- Maintain records, files, and logs in laboratory notebooks and computer databases
- Compile study data and results for publications, grants, and seminar presentations
- Work closely with the principal investigator
- Perform related responsibilities as required by the principal investigator
- Bachelor's degree in a scientific field OR equivalent combination of experience, education, and training
- Previous research experience
- Background in a STEM field such as biology or neuroscience
- Experience working with Drosophila, using neuroscience techniques, and/or programming is favorably considered
- Good organizational and problem‑solving skills
- Ability to multitask
- Attention to detail
- A one- to two‑year commitment is expected
- Ability to work with, take precautions against and/or be immunized against potentially hazardous agents may be required
- Cover letter describing scientific background and interest in the lab
